The HR Advisor provides high-quality, professional HR support to managers and employees across the business. Acting as a first point of contact for day-to-day people matters, the role delivers guidance on policy, employee relations, performance, and general HR operations. The HR Advisor works closely with the wider People team to ensure consistent, fair, and legally compliant people practices that contribute to a positive employee experience and strong organisational culture.

Reporting to the People Business Partner, this is an ideal role for someone with previous HR Advisor experience or a HR Admin ready to take the next step. You will have a solution focused mindset, be detail orientated and enjoy working in a fast paced but supportive environment.

Key Responsibilities:
  • Provide support to People Business Partners on a variety of topics including employee relations cases and the cyclical People team activity.
  • Monitor, analyse and manage absence. Identify trends and propose solutions as appropriate.
  • Support with on/off boarding processes, including conducting first day induction, employee check-in meetings, and probation process tracking.
  • Conduct exit interviews and ensure insights are appropriately considered to promote continuous improvement.
  • Work with People team colleagues in the Operation and L&D verticals in support of continuous process improvement and support project deliver.
  • Participate in various People team change initiatives, programs and policies as we continue to innovate our systems and processes.
Qualifications:
  • Previous generalist HR Advisor experience ideally in the Tech or a fast-paced industry.
  • Proven experience in advising and coaching managers and colleagues on best practice, policy and process.
  • Experience managing ER cases (end to end). Developing employment law knowledge is essential.
  • Demonstrates creative thinking and problem-solving skills.
  • Excellent interpersonal and communication skills.
  • The ability to build and maintain relationships to work cross functions and confidently with multiple stakeholders.
  • Experience of delivering and working through Change is desirable.
  • Experience working with HRIS and LMS systems would be beneficial.
  • CIPD qualification or working towards is desirable but not essential.
